U+11EEA "饝华" Makasar Letter Ja is a character from the Makasar script, a Brahmic-based abugida historically used to write the Makassarese language in South Sulawesi, Indonesia. This specific letter represents the sound "ja" and is part of the Makasar block in Unicode, which was added in version 9.0 in 2016 to preserve and digitally support the endangered script. The Makasar script was traditionally used for writing on palm leaves and documents before being largely supplanted by the Latin alphabet, and the inclusion of the "Ja" character in Unicode helps facilitate modern digital use, including in text processing and historical studies of the language.
